This PR adds a GitHub Actions workflow that enables Claude Code integration in our repository.
What is Claude Code?
Claude Code is an AI coding agent that can help with:
Bug fixes and improvements
Documentation updates
Implementing new features
Code reviews and suggestions
Writing tests
And more!
How it works
Once this PR is merged, we'll be able to interact with Claude by mentioning @claude in a pull request or issue comment.
Once the workflow is triggered, Claude will analyze the comment and surrounding context, and execute on the request in a GitHub action.
Important Notes
This workflow won't take effect until this PR is merged
@claude mentions won't work until after the merge is complete
The workflow runs automatically whenever Claude is mentioned in PR or issue comments
Claude gets access to the entire PR or issue context including files, diffs, and previous comments
Security
Our Anthropic API key is securely stored as a GitHub Actions secret
Only users with write access to the repository can trigger the workflow
All Claude runs are stored in the GitHub Actions run history
Claude's default tools are limited to reading/writing files and interacting with our repo by creating comments, branches, and commits.
We can add more allowed tools by adding them to the workflow file like:
allowed_tools: Bash(npm install),Bash(npm run build),Bash(npm run lint),Bash(npm run test)
Both workflows have commented-out allowed_tools which means Claude can't run tests or linting by default.
Recommendation: Uncomment and configure based on your stack:
# For Node.js projectsallowed_tools: "Bash(npm install),Bash(npm run build),Bash(npm run test),Bash(npm run lint)"
🔍 Potential Issues
1. Duplicate Workflows
Having both claude-code-review.yml and claude.yml might cause confusion. The automatic review workflow might trigger alongside manual @claude mentions.
Recommendation: Consider if you need both, or add conditions to prevent overlap.
2. Resource Usage
# claude-code-review.yml:21runs-on: ubuntu-latest
Consideration: Both workflows use ubuntu-latest which is appropriate, but for cost optimization, consider ubuntu-22.04 for more predictable pricing.
3. Missing Error Handling
No timeout or retry logic for the Claude Code action.
Recommendation: Add timeout protection:
- name: Run Claude Codetimeout-minutes: 30continue-on-error: true
📋 Missing Elements
1. Test Coverage
The workflows themselves don't have tests. Consider adding a test workflow to validate the YAML syntax and basic functionality.
2. Monitoring
No built-in monitoring or logging configuration for tracking Claude usage or failures.
